Josh Richards is poised to captivate global dancefloors with the melodic essence of his new single ‘Metal’. With past successes like ‘Anthurium’, Richards maintains his melodic and progressive style.

Emerging from the lively music scene in Melbourne, Australia, Josh Richards has been leaving an indelible impression since 2022. After a successful collaboration with Flow Music, Richards continues to push the boundaries of melodic techno and house, affirming his status as an up-and-coming artist in the electronic music sector. Through ‘Metal,’ his latest single, he leads us on another captivating musical excursion.

The track opens with a commanding beat, setting the tone for what’s to come. Richards effortlessly weaves uplifting melodies and broad pads into the pulsating rhythm, creating an ethereal ambiance within the hypnotic groove. Josh Richards artfully integrates metallic percussion accents to enhance the track’s allure, crafting an enchanting auditory experience.

However, the distinctive element of ‘Metal’ lies in the inclusion of the striking remix by Bulgarian producer Stan Kolev. Renowned for his progressive influence, Kolev contributes his flair, taking the track to unprecedented heights. The remixed version incorporates spherical synths and nuanced melodic components juxtaposed with a raw bassline, resulting in an immersive sonic experience.

Josh Richards emerges as a noteworthy figure, steadily leaving his imprint on the worldwide electronic music scene. The release promises a distinctive auditory experience, showcasing his evolving artistry and setting the stage for future endeavors.
